Advocacy Files Comments on 2019-2024 National Outer Continental Shelf Oil and Gas Leasing Draft Proposed Program

March 9, 2018

The U.S. Small Business Administration’s Office of Advocacy (Advocacy) applauds the United States Department of the Interior’s Bureau of Ocean Energy Management (BOEM)’s efforts to expand the area of the outer continental shelf (OCS) available for oil and gas leasing, as these efforts have the potential to benefit small businesses by creating new opportunities for small entities to enter and remain competitive in the industry. Advocacy appreciates BOEM’s efforts to engage the public on its proposal and respectfully submits the following comments on BOEM’s request for public comment on the Draft Proposed Program (DPP). Advocacy encourages BOEM to consider the impacts to small entities when making final decisions regarding the proposal.
